From 9c729c77bc604f628c3133d6ff1b7d280cedbe53 Mon Sep 17 00:00:00 2001 From: Smittytron Date: Mon, 20 Nov 2017 19:12:21 -0600 Subject: [PATCH] Add Real tough guy difficulty to Allies04 --- mods/ra/maps/allies-04/allies04-AI.lua | 6 ++++-- mods/ra/maps/allies-04/allies04.lua | 12 ++++++++---- mods/ra/maps/allies-04/rules.yaml | 1 + 3 files changed, 13 insertions(+), 6 deletions(-) diff --git a/mods/ra/maps/allies-04/allies04-AI.lua b/mods/ra/maps/allies-04/allies04-AI.lua index 11ac498f57..bb20e2d520 100644 --- a/mods/ra/maps/allies-04/allies04-AI.lua +++ b/mods/ra/maps/allies-04/allies04-AI.lua @@ -14,14 +14,16 @@ AttackGroupSizes = { easy = 6, normal = 8, - hard = 10 + hard = 10, + tough = 12 } AttackDelays = { easy = { DateTime.Seconds(4), DateTime.Seconds(9) }, normal = { DateTime.Seconds(2), DateTime.Seconds(7) }, - hard = { DateTime.Seconds(1), DateTime.Seconds(5) } + hard = { DateTime.Seconds(1), DateTime.Seconds(5) }, + tough = { DateTime.Seconds(1), DateTime.Seconds(5) } } AttackRallyPoints = diff --git a/mods/ra/maps/allies-04/allies04.lua b/mods/ra/maps/allies-04/allies04.lua index 2c217a96bd..3f73b2aa71 100644 --- a/mods/ra/maps/allies-04/allies04.lua +++ b/mods/ra/maps/allies-04/allies04.lua @@ -24,28 +24,32 @@ ConvoyDelays = { easy = { DateTime.Minutes(4), DateTime.Minutes(5) + DateTime.Seconds(20) }, normal = { DateTime.Minutes(2) + DateTime.Seconds(30), DateTime.Minutes(4) }, - hard = { DateTime.Minutes(1) + DateTime.Seconds(30), DateTime.Minutes(2) + DateTime.Seconds(30) } + hard = { DateTime.Minutes(1) + DateTime.Seconds(30), DateTime.Minutes(2) + DateTime.Seconds(30) }, + tough = { DateTime.Minutes(1), DateTime.Minutes(1) + DateTime.Seconds(15) } } Convoys = { easy = 2, normal = 3, - hard = 5 + hard = 5, + tough = 10 } ParadropDelays = { easy = { DateTime.Seconds(40), DateTime.Seconds(90) }, normal = { DateTime.Seconds(30), DateTime.Seconds(70) }, - hard = { DateTime.Seconds(20), DateTime.Seconds(50) } + hard = { DateTime.Seconds(20), DateTime.Seconds(50) }, + tough = { DateTime.Seconds(10), DateTime.Seconds(25) } } ParadropWaves = { easy = 4, normal = 6, - hard = 10 + hard = 10, + tough = 25 } ParadropLZs = { ParadropPoint1.CenterPosition, ParadropPoint2.CenterPosition, ParadropPoint3.CenterPosition } diff --git a/mods/ra/maps/allies-04/rules.yaml b/mods/ra/maps/allies-04/rules.yaml index a24ebc16cb..1c2cd15e2f 100644 --- a/mods/ra/maps/allies-04/rules.yaml +++ b/mods/ra/maps/allies-04/rules.yaml @@ -20,6 +20,7 @@ World: easy: Easy normal: Normal hard: Hard + tough: Real tough guy Default: easy powerproxy.paratroopers: